Yes, we really are in the mountains, so there are lots of exciting places to explore on foot in the cool of the early morning or when the sun is not so fierce. Expect temperatures to be around 30°C.

There are plenty of amazing walks in this region, including the El Torcal Park Nature Reserve. Click this link to read more about El Torcal. You are advised to bring sun hat, sunglasses and sun lotion; and a small rucsac for carrying water and lunch. Also bring a camera for some amazing shots.

mountain walkAlora is our nearest town, within easy walking distance, so one of our mornings will be spent in walking to it, having lunch, and browsing the shops. We are keen that you get a lot of fun, so we will create opportunities to have a dip in a mountain stream, during our walks!

mountain swim These are not intended to be challenging activities for seasoned walkers, but should be seen as a gentle way of discovering the Spanish spirit through it's landscape.
